An In-Depth Look at the Experience

Murder Mystery Detective Experience in Ann Arbor MI - An In-Depth Look at the Experience

What to Expect from the Tour

The Murder Mystery Detective Experience is designed as a 2.5-hour interactive audio adventure. Once you book, you’ll receive instructions via email or text, allowing you to participate at your convenience—day or night. The experience begins at 219 Chapin St., Ann Arbor, and ends back at the same spot, making it easy to incorporate into your day.

This is a self-guided activity, meaning there are no guides or groups to keep pace with. You’ll be prompted to visit 10 different locations in downtown Ann Arbor or outskirts, depending on whether you choose the walking or driving map. Each stop involves listening to a part of the story, collecting clues, and analyzing evidence to identify the murderer.

Practical Details and Tips

  • Cost: At $14.99 per person, it’s quite accessible compared to other guided tours or escape rooms.
  • Duration: Expect around 2.5 hours, but you can take breaks or extend the experience.
  • Tech Requirements: A charged smartphone and earbuds are essential for clear audio.
  • Number of Devices: The number of tickets you purchase equals your devices, so plan accordingly if playing in a group.
  • Accessibility: The activity isn’t suitable for young children due to mature references and adult content.
  • Customer Service: Assistance is available if you encounter technical issues during the game.
